    Cain/Giants only -110 against Gallardo/Brewers?

    Sharps help me out here...

    Giants lost 2 to Brewers already... and this game is to avoid a sweep. Giants are the defending World Series champs and have their ace on the mound who hasn't won a game yet (nor has the team in any of the 3 games he has pitched.) Gallardo has been inconsistent, and this is the perfect game for the sometimes lackluster Giants offense to score some runs behind a solid pitcher in Matt Cain.

    All logic would point to a Giants win. I was originally expecting a line in the area of -150. Regardless of the last few games, Giants are a public team and Cain is a public pitcher. Fukking Kershaw was like -260 yesterday.

    However, the line was at -135 and went down as low as -105 at some places, despite a majority of the public being on the Giants. Posey was a 20 cent drop? Smells fishy. I know you shouldn't read to heavily into the lines, especially in baseball, but what gives? Is Brewers the play?

    Cain hasn't displayed the 2012 form. Also, everyone talks about Mil bp but SF bp hasn't been much to write home about.

    PRIOR to last night's game, the stats:

    Giants BP 4.44 ERA/1.274 WHIP/12 RUNS/22 HITS/4 HRs/9 WALKS/23 K's on the Road

    Brewers BP 4.85 ERA/1.517 WHIP/19 RUNS/34 HITS/6 HRs/11 WALKS/30 K's at Home

    As you can see, there isn't a big of a difference as most people think. I passed SF/MIL yesterday and will probably pass today as I see more interesting angles to exploit.
